September 11th
It's been years that you've been gone
I never knew I would be alone
Your clothes still hang in the closet next to mine
I can still taste your favorite wine
On September 11th I got a call
All that smoke had you up against a wall
You said everything will be alright
That you weren't giving up with out a fight
I watched the news all afternoon
Praying to see you-- not a moment to soon
Smoke and firemen was all you would see
People screaming to be free
The buildings was burning
And my eyes were to from crying
Deep inside my heart was dying
Never knowing if I would see you again; my husband, my best friend
When the people got free I cried
Praying to see you standing in the crowd
I never saw you standing out there
Emotions raw, staying home I couldn't bear
I went to the scene and a policeman stopped me
I cried my husbands up there somebody please help me
He said they were doing all they could do
I'll never forget the men all in blue
It's been five years that he's been gone
My love for him is still very strong
Everyone were heros on that fateful day
I'll never forget him as I continue to pray.
